Comprehending Cold Laser Therapy
Cold laser treatment, likewise known as low-level laser treatment (LLLT), is an ingenious approach to hair repair that harnesses details wavelengths of light to stimulate hair follicles. This non-invasive therapy promotes hair development by improving mobile activity and improving blood circulation in the scalp.
When you undertake this therapy, you'll discover that the low-level laser light penetrates the skin, energizing the hair follicles and encouraging them to enter the development stage of the hair cycle.
You might wonder exactly how this procedure works. The light discharged during the therapy turns on the mitochondria within your cells, enhancing power production and promoting the recovery procedure. Because of this, your hair follicles can recoup from any damage, resulting in healthier hair growth.
This treatment is generally pain-free and calls for no downtime, making it a practical alternative for several people looking for hair repair.
Normal sessions can assist you accomplish the most effective outcomes, as uniformity is key in reaping the benefits of cold laser therapy. With each session, you're providing your hair follicles the assistance they require to prosper, leading to thicker, fuller hair with time.

Recommended Therapy Schedules
When planning your therapy routine for hair repair, uniformity is crucial to attaining optimal results. The majority of professionals advise beginning with three sessions each week for the very first month. This constant treatment helps kickstart the hair repair process by promoting hair follicles and promoting circulation in the scalp.
As you proceed, you can progressively decrease the frequency to two sessions per week for the adhering to 2 to 3 months. This adjustment enables your scalp to proceed gaining from the therapy while giving you some versatility in your timetable.
Hereafter initial period, numerous find that once-a-week sessions can keep the outcomes you've accomplished, specifically if you're incorporating cold laser treatment with other hair repair techniques.
Always pay attention to your body; if you feel any kind of pain or don't see results, consult your doctor for customized advice. Tracking your progress can likewise assist you establish if changes to your routine are needed.
